Output e4089210aa6843912d1d445efa4fd4470591a009cb36aea9e49eb0b245307303:1

value
2734314
script pubkey
OP_0 OP_PUSHBYTES_20 16b07985ffae216074d9a50547fb569c9224f2aa
address
bc1qz6c8np0l4cskqaxe55z5076knjfzfu42kdxx5e
transaction
e4089210aa6843912d1d445efa4fd4470591a009cb36aea9e49eb0b245307303
confirmations
144482
spent
true